Can deaf cats hear ultrasonic sounds?
Even a clapping sound may be "heard" by a deaf cat. They can supposedly hear sounds from 45 to 60,000 hertz. To put into perspective, humans can only hear from 20 to 20,000 hertz. Actually, any sound above 20,000 is considered ultrasonic - so your cat can hear all sorts of things that you never will. What sounds do cats hate?

Why do cats hate noise?
Why is my cat scared of noises? Just as in humans, all cats have some degree of normal fear when they hear loud, sudden or strange noises. Itā€™s part of our survival instinct. Some cats, however, are especially sensitive to noise or display exaggerated responses to certain sounds. Do cats hate bells on their collars?
According to Veterinary PhD student Rachel Malakani, a collar bell will produce sound at about 50-60 dB, but studies have shown cats to be unaffected by sounds under 80 dB. While some cats with anxiety may not react well to the bell's sound, it's likely that the majority of cats simply won't care.
Do cats hear differently from humans?
You are most sensitive to sounds of around 3,000 Hz (most human voices are near that pitch), while your cat is most sensitive to sounds of around 8,000 Hertz. A cat's pinna funnels sound waves into the ear canal, where the waves strike the ear drum.
